| Brand | Weidmüller | |
| Product Type | Pluggable Terminal Block | |
| Number of Contacts | 16 | |
| Pitch | 3.5mm | |
| Current | 7.9A | |
| Number of Rows | 1 | |
| Housing Material | Fibreglass Liquid Crystal Polymer | |
| Connector Gender | Male | |
| Orientation | 90° | |
| Termination Type | Solder | |
| Colour | Black | |
| Voltage | 200 V | |
| Width | 15.4 mm | |
| Length | 24.5mm | |
| Series | OMNIMATE Signal | |
| Depth | 24.4mm | |
| Standards/Approvals | IEC 60664-1, UL, CSA, RoHS, IEC 61984 | |
